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Centers - Willard, WI.

Short Term substance abuse rehabilitation is a phrase used for addiction rehab that does not last long and   lasts   from fourteen to thirty days in either a residential or in-patient treatment center. Because rehab is so brief, it is a great financial option and for people who for some reason cannot commit to long-term rehab.

Most short-term alcohol and drug rehab facilities in Willard have intensive group and individual counseling and psychotherapy which in the context of addiction treatment is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the brief time allowed for treatment services, most clients will need to be fully detoxed before beginning services. One of the disadvantages of rehab at a short-term substance abuse rehabilitation program is that people may still be in the initial phases of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has stabilized and detoxed completely. This can make treatment within the timeframe much more challenging, as people may be physically uncomfortable and moody and experiencing intense cravings.

Recidivism rates are understandably higher with people who only get short term treatment as opposed to long term. People who participate in short term alcohol and drug rehab and then phase into an intensive outpatient program or day treatment program have better odds of maintaining their sobriety, because they will maintain a support system while they progress in their new sober lifestyle.
